Parting-Off and Grooving
Parting-off and grooving are two essential machining methods in turning.
Parting-off is a process in which a desired component is cut off from the material. It is often performed on a lathe, where the tool moves transversely across the workpiece to cut it off. Parting-off is one of the basic operations in machine-shop production and plays an important role, for example, in high-volume production on lathes equipped with bar feeders. Parting tools are specially designed for this task and are built to withstand the heavy loads and vibration typically encountered during parting-off.
Grooving, as the name suggests, focuses on machining grooves into the material. Grooving can be used for a variety of purposes, such as creating retaining-ring grooves, seal grooves, or belt grooves. Depending on its intended application, a groove may be deep or shallow, wide or narrow. Specialized grooving tools are used to produce grooves accurately and efficiently.
